
This recipe is perfect for those on a fitness journey or looking for a high-protein vegetarian meal. These wraps are made with delicious homemade tikkis, a creamy high-protein yogurt dressing, and wrapped in whole wheat tortillas or leftover rotis. It's a healthy, protein-packed, and flavorful option for any meal of the day.

Smash the kala chana and mix it with shredded low-fat paneer, chopped onion, besan, cumin powder, coriander powder, garam masala powder, salt, and chopped coriander.
Form the mixture into small patties. This recipe makes approximately 12 patties.
Spray or grease a pan with oil and shallow fry the patties until they are crisp and golden brown on both sides.
Mix high-protein Greek yogurt with garlic powder, ketchup, chopped coriander, and a pinch of salt until well combined.
Take a whole wheat tortilla or leftover roti and place 4-5 tikkis in the center.
Drizzle the prepared dressing over the tikkis.
Wrap the tortilla or roti tightly around the filling and serve.
You can prepare the tikkis in advance and store them in the refrigerator for up to 2 days.
For an extra crunch, add some shredded lettuce or sliced cucumbers to the wrap.
Adjust the spices in the tikki mixture according to your taste preference.
Can I use canned chickpeas instead of kala chana?
Yes, you can use canned chickpeas as a substitute for kala chana. Just make sure to drain and rinse them before mashing.
Can I make this recipe vegan?
Yes, you can replace paneer with tofu and use a plant-based yogurt for the dressing to make it vegan.
How do I store leftover wraps?
Wrap the prepared wraps tightly in foil or plastic wrap and store them in the refrigerator for up to 1 day. Reheat before serving.
Can I bake the tikkis instead of frying?
Yes, you can bake the tikkis in a preheated oven at 375°F (190°C) for about 20-25 minutes, flipping halfway through.
What can I use instead of whole wheat tortillas?
You can use any flatbread like naan, pita bread, or even regular rotis as a substitute for whole wheat tortillas.
